Aircommand have created the Cormorant for the Australian Market. It is an affordable reverse cycle roof top air conditioner that is packed full of features.
Being a reverse cycle air conditioner means the Cormorant has high efficiency and provides one of the most economical forms of heating.
The Cormorant is:
-fully reverse-cycle, suitable for heating and cooling fully insulated caravans and motor homes up to 23ft (external) in length
-remote controlled so you can adjust your comfort level anywhere within your caravan or RV
-fitted with built in compressor protection against intermittent power supply
-designed to dehumidify the air to help asthma suffers
-fitted with a stylish internal plenum.
If this unit is to be added to an older caravan/motorhome you may need to also purchase a H frame. These metal frames, stradle the roof from one side to other, transferring the weight to the top of the walls. Many newer caravans have framing built inside the roof. Please check with the manufacturer if unsure. Fitting instructions come with the unit, however a licenced electrician is required to connect the 240v wiring.
General Specifications : Cormorant
Electrical rating (single phase): 230-240V, 50Hz
Nominal cooling capacity: 3.5kW
Nominal heating capacity: 4.2kW
Maximum rated current: cooling 6.1A
Maximum rated current: heating 7.8A
Maximum L/R current: 22A
Air delivery maximum: 140l/s
Installed weight (including plenum): 47kg
Dimensions
Overall height: 346mm
Overall width: 740mm
Overall depth: 1115mm
Air-discharge plenum height: 75mm
Air-discharge plenum width : 570mm
Air-discharge plenum length: 650mm
